Here is what is lighting up the city this June: The Return of the Bunte Republik Neustadt (BRN) Festival Get ready for the most vibrant weekend of the year! The Bunte Republik Neustadt (Colorful Republic of Neustadt) transforms the trendy Äußere Neustadt district into a massive, lively street festival. Expect a spectacular celebration of Dresden's alternative and creative spirit. The streets will be closed to traffic and filled instead with live music stages, spontaneous DJ sets, eclectic art installations, and incredible street food from around the world. It is a one-of-a-kind neighborhood block party that perfectly captures the bohemian heart of Dresden.

Dresden Museum Night (Museumsnacht) Culture owls, rejoice! Dresden’s famous Museum Night returns this June, offering exclusive after-hours access to the city’s world-class cultural institutions. Dozens of museums, galleries, and historic sites—from the royal treasures of the Zwinger and the Residenzschloss to the contemporary halls of the Albertinum—will keep their doors open late into the night. Your ticket grants you access not only to the regular exhibits but also to special guided tours, live performances, outdoor light shows, and interactive workshops. Romantic Opera: Der Freischütz
Experience Carl Maria von Weber's romantic opera 'Der Freischütz' at the open-air theater Felsenbühne Rathen. The story follows a young hunter, Max, who makes a pact with the devil to win the hand of his beloved Agathe.

Elbhangfest
An art and civic festival held along Dresden's Elbe slope between the villages of Loschwitz and Pillnitz, featuring concerts, theatre, and dance events.
